High-intent keywords indicate a strong user intention to purchase or take a specific action. While specific data on FullStory's high-intent keywords and conversion rates is limited, some potential high-intent keywords for FullStory could include:
FullStory likely utilizes tools like Google Search Console and keyword research tools to identify high-intent keywords and track their conversion rates16. They may also prioritize high buying-intent, low-volume keywords over low buying-intent, high-volume keywords, recognizing that these keywords often convert at a higher rate and are easier to rank for due to lower competition17. Additionally, FullStory might be leveraging category keywords, which have high buying intent and can drive significant conversions18.
By creating content and landing pages optimized for these high-intent keywords, FullStory can attract users who are more likely to convert into customers, further contributing to their organic traffic growth.
